Transaction 64383094cd9e84b537fedd78af830746ffbe27d4837f6d70255a665e16a0a12b
1 Input
1 Output
-
64383094cd9e84b537fedd78af830746ffbe27d4837f6d70255a665e16a0a12b:0
- value
- 995780
- script pubkey
- OP_0 OP_PUSHBYTES_32 ee8031d3c4dd2dbf6a4332aae4283c22734efdbc5a53f84929439ee17a5f77cd
- address
- bc1qa6qrr57ym5km76jrx24wg2puyfe5aldutfflsjffgw0wz7jlwlxsjpehlt